Transaction 5123e961fab6a4b8e8d44b434ea4989ccc831daf3ad3ae6a18afed8ba690ae21
1 Input
2 Outputs
- 5123e961fab6a4b8e8d44b434ea4989ccc831daf3ad3ae6a18afed8ba690ae21:0
- 5123e961fab6a4b8e8d44b434ea4989ccc831daf3ad3ae6a18afed8ba690ae21:1
value 2500000
address 1D9uhuo4RWmSGQCsZ9JQzwsUWEGosqRyge
value 4536731904
address 158HGCK179yop6PRBUpuHVJogYvGKiJKwh